Theory Group
Center for Functional Nanomaterials
Brookhaven National Laboratory
Postdoctoral Research Associate (Job ID 584):
Requires a PhD in physics, chemistry or materials science with primary focus on theoretical research. Candidates should have a strong record of research experience, including the development and use of computational methods for application to nanostructured materials. Research projects will be directed to developing models for complex interfaces and understanding the influence on electronic characteristics and chemical interactions. These projects will be connected with key CFN research themes (interface science, heterogeneous catalysis, photocatalysis, or materials for energy storage). Interest in and experience with methods for many-body perturbation theory or spectroscopy (valence or core related) will be considered. Position working with Dr. Mark Hybertsen, leader of the Theory and Computation Group in the Center for Functional Nanomaterials.
Application procedure: See on-line listings and instructions at http://www.bnl.gov/cfn/jobs.
BNL Policy states that research associate appointments may be made to individuals who have received their doctorate within the past five years.
